
Kaldet B-L4S5I-IOT01A STM32 Discovery kit, det er bygget op omkring en STM32L4 + mikrokontroller og har sensorer, et sikkert element (STSAFE-A110), NFC, Wi-Fi og Bluetooth 4.2.
Det har brug for gratis at downloade X-Cube-AWS v2.0 STM32Cube-udvidelsespakke, som er et sæt biblioteker og applikationseksempler til mikrokontrollere, der fungerer som slutenheder - og det er her havnen i FreeRTOS kommer fra. Havnen er ifølge ST kvalificeret til AWS.
Udvidelsespakken (venstre) aflæsser, når det er tilgængeligt, sikkerhedskritiske operationer til det sikre element under MCU-startprocessen, under TLS-enhedsgodkendelse mod AWS 'IoT Core' -server og under verifikation af over-the-air (OTA ) opdater firmwarebilledintegritet og ægthed. Det bruger det sikre element tilvejebragte certifikat med AWS 'IoT Core Multi-Account Registration' funktion.
”Med udvidelsespakken kan sættet bruges som referencedesign,” ifølge ST. “X-CUBE-AWS v2.0 sikrer korrekt integration af FreeRTOS standard AWS-tilslutningsrammer inden for STM32Cube-miljøet. Dette giver brugerne mulighed for at udnytte både FreeRTOS og STM32Cube uden at udvikle yderligere software. ”
MCU er en Arm Cortex-M4 STM32L4S5VIT6 med 2Mbyte flash, 640kbyte RAM og en hardwarekrypteringsaccelerator.
Indbyggede sensorer er:
- HTS221 kapacitiv digital relativ fugtighed og temperatur
- LIS3MDL 3-akset magnetometer
- LSM6DSL 3D accelerometer og 3D gyroskop
- LPS22HB absolut barometer
- VL53L0X flyvetid og gestusdetektor
- To digitale mikrofoner
Til udvidelse findes der stik til udvidelseskort, der er kompatible med Arduino Uno V3 og Pmod-kort.
Produktsiden til udviklingssættet er her
ST's FreeRTOS-side er her
Udvidelsespakken kan downloades fra her - vær forberedt på en licensaftale. En datakort er også tilgængelig via denne side.
AWS 'guide til kvalificering af FreeRTOS er her sammen med andre dokumenter